* Don Stults has been promoted to senior vice president of operations for Iwerks Entertainment, Burbank, the company said. Stults will oversee all aspects of Iwerks’ operations, including product development, project services, engineering, manufacturing and purchasing. He most recently served as vice president of operations.

Iwerks Entertainment Inc. is a full-service provider of film-based entertainment attractions.

* Mahesh Soni has been appointed director of broadband business development with Best Data Products, Chatsworth, the company said. He will be responsible for procuring technology partners and customers in the cable and telecommunications industries and marketing the company’s new high-speed broadband products.

Best Data develops, manufactures and markets data communications products from analog modems top high-speed cable modems.

* David Bartels has been appointed director of sales and marketing for Market Scan, Westlake Village, the company said. He will be responsible for retail installment contracts. Bartels had been with Diamond Technology, where he was vice president of sales and marketing and a member of the board.

Market Scan develops and markets automobile leasing technology.

* Andrew P. Mooney has been named president of Disney Consumer Products Worldwide, Burbank, the company said. Mooney will oversee licensing for the Disney Stores, Disney Interactive and Disney Publishing. He replaces Anne E. Osberg, who is leaving to pursue other opportunities. Mooney had been chief marketing officer and head of global apparel with Nike Inc.

* Robert Musslewhite has been appointed to Act Networks Inc.’s board of directors, the Calabasas-based company announced. Musslewhite is a former senior vice president of corporate development at Marconi/FORE Systems.

ACT Networks develops and manufactures multi-service access products for integrated voice and data networking applications in the information and telecommunications industry.
